Design and Build Quality

The Apple iPad Pro 12.9 (2017) is designed with a sleek and modern aesthetic that aligns with Apple’s standard for elegance and minimalism. The dimensions of the tablet are 305.7 x 220.6 x 6.9 mm, and it weighs 677 g for the Wi-Fi model and 692 g for the LTE model. The device is available in three colors: Space Gray, Gold, and Silver, allowing users to choose according to their preferences.

The build quality is robust, thanks to the use of high-grade aluminum and scratch-resistant glass. Moreover, the oleophobic coating helps reduce fingerprint smudges on the screen, maintaining the display’s clarity and cleanliness effortlessly.

Display Features

The iPad Pro 12.9 boasts a large 12.9-inch IPS LCD display with a resolution of 2732 x 2048 pixels and a 4:3 aspect ratio. This results in a high pixel density of approximately 265 pixels per inch, ensuring sharp and crisp visuals. The screen-to-body ratio is about 76.4%, providing ample screen real estate for users who value display space.

A significant feature of the display is its 120Hz refresh rate, which enhances the touchscreen and stylus (Apple Pencil) experience by making interactions smooth and responsive. Additionally, the screen supports HDR content, which is great for watching movies and editing photos in vibrant and dynamic color ranges.

Performance Capabilities

Under the hood, the iPad Pro 12.9 is powered by the Apple A10X Fusion chip, with a 10 nm architecture. This hexa-core CPU features three Hurricane cores for high performance and three Zephyr cores for efficient processing. The device also includes a 12-core PowerVR Series 7 GPU, providing exceptional graphics processing capabilities.

The device includes 4GB of RAM across all storage variants (64GB, 256GB, and 512GB). While there is no card slot for expanded storage, the available capacity should be adequate for most users’ needs, especially with cloud storage options available.

Camera and Photography

The iPad Pro 12.9 features a 12 MP rear camera with an f/1.8 aperture, with PDAF (Phase Detection Autofocus) and OIS (Optical Image Stabilization), which help in capturing vibrant and sharp photos. The quad-LED dual-tone flash and HDR support add to the photography capabilities, enabling great shots even in low light.

When it comes to video, the rear camera can shoot 4K videos at 30fps, 1080p videos at up to 120fps, and slow-motion videos at 720p up to 240fps.

The front-facing camera is 7 MP with an f/2.2 aperture, which supports 1080p video recording at 30fps. Features like face detection, HDR, and panorama further enhance the selfie and video call quality.

Audio and Speaker System

The iPad Pro is equipped with a four-speaker audio system, delivering stereo sound that enhances media consumption experiences such as music listening and movie watching. The inclusion of a 3.5mm headphone jack is a practical feature for those who prefer wired audio solutions.

Connectivity Options

On the connectivity front, the iPad Pro supports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ac with dual-band and hotspot capabilities. Bluetooth 4.2 ensures smooth connectivity with peripherals and accessories. The positioning system includes GPS and GLONASS support in the Wi-Fi + Cellular model.

Although NFC and USB are supported, the connection ports are primarily managed through Apple’s proprietary Lightning port, which supports high-speed USB 3.0 data transfers and charging.

Battery Life

The iPad Pro 12.9 comes with a powerful non-removable 10,891mAh (41 Wh) Li-Ion battery, capable of delivering up to 10 hours of multimedia use. This makes it a suitable option for users who need long battery life for travel or long working hours without frequent charging.

Sensors and Additional Features

The device features a range of sensors, including a front-mounted fingerprint sensor for secure biometric authentication, an accelerometer, a gyroscope, a compass, and a barometer. Apple iPad Pro 12.9 (2017) Key Disadvantages

  • Heavy Weight: At 677 g (Wi-Fi) / 692 g (LTE), it might feel cumbersome for extended use.
  • No Expandable Storage: The lack of a memory card slot restricts storage upgrade potential.
  • Older Bluetooth Version: Utilizes Bluetooth 4.2 instead of the more advanced 5.0.
  • No FM Radio: Missing support for FM radio might be a downside for some users.
  • High Price: Initially priced around 900 EUR, it may not fit all budgets.
